Planning a trip to Wroclaw in August? You are in luck! The weather is generally good, with an average maximum temperature of +75°F and approximately 10 sunny days. Just be prepared for some rain, as there are usually around 8 rainy days and 75 mm of precipitation. Expect good weather and pack accordingly to enjoy the outdoors. In August 2023 Wroclaw had 24 sunny days, 2 cloudy days, and 4 rainy days. The average maximum temperature was +81°F, with an absolute maximum of +95°F and a minimum of +63°F. The average humidity was 71%, with a maximum of 99% and a minimum of 26%. The average wind speed was 2 m/s, with a maximum of 8 m/s and a minimum of 0 m/s.

Climate Change Over the Years

This is how Wroclaw climate has changed over the last 43 years.

The climate in Wroclaw in August has not changed that much over the last 43 years.

The average temperature was the lowest in 1987 (+69°F) and the highest in 2013 (+87°F). The driest year was 2015 with only 28 mm of rainfall, and the wettest year was 2022 with 337 mm.

Source of the data

For this page, we’ve looked at the typical weather in Wroclaw, based on historical hourly weather data from January 1, 1979, to December 31, 2022.

For past dates, we show actual recorded data at the location at that time. Forecasts are based on recorded weather during that day of the year, averaged over the total years for which we have records (unless stated otherwise). The daily temperature is the highest recorded temperature in the shadow during that day.
